What the Office of Inspector General Evaluated

The objective of the audit was to evaluate the Integrated Support Services division compliance with the Library of Congress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ement, which provides guidance for the solicitation, award, administration, and closeout of Library contracts.

What the Office of Inspector General Found

We found that that ISS complied with Library policies and procedures governing the procurement, award, and administration of the selected contracts and task orders.

What the Office of Inspector General Recommends

No recommendations were made within this report.
